Transition from MailMan.GetHeaders to MailMan.FetchRange

Provides instructions for replacing deprecated GetHeaders method calls with FetchRange.

Visual FoxPro
LOCAL lnSuccess
LOCAL loMailman
LOCAL lnNumBodyLines
LOCAL lnFromIndex
LOCAL lnToIndex
LOCAL loBundleObj
LOCAL lnKeepOnServer
LOCAL lnHeadersOnly
LOCAL loBundleOut

lnSuccess = 0

loMailman = CreateObject('Chilkat.MailMan')

* ...
* ...

lnNumBodyLines = 3
lnFromIndex = 0
lnToIndex = 9

* ------------------------------------------------------------------------
* The GetHeaders method is deprecated:

loBundleObj = loMailman.GetHeaders(lnNumBodyLines,lnFromIndex,lnToIndex)
IF (loMailman.LastMethodSuccess = 0) THEN
    ? loMailman.LastErrorText
    RELEASE loMailman
    CANCEL
ENDIF

* ...
* ...

RELEASE loBundleObj

* ------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Do the equivalent using FetchRange.
* Your application creates a new, empty EmailBundle object which is passed 
* in the last argument and filled upon success.

lnKeepOnServer = 1
lnHeadersOnly = 1

loBundleOut = CreateObject('Chilkat.EmailBundle')
lnSuccess = loMailman.FetchRange(lnKeepOnServer,lnHeadersOnly,lnNumBodyLines,lnFromIndex,lnToIndex,loBundleOut)
IF (lnSuccess = 0) THEN
    ? loMailman.LastErrorText
    RELEASE loMailman
    RELEASE loBundleOut
    CANCEL
ENDIF

RELEASE loMailman
RELEASE loBundleOut
